#ff1dc8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ff1dc8 is composed of 100% red, 11.4%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.6%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 314.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 55.7%. #ff1dc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3aff with #ff0091.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

Shades and Tints of #ff1dc8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090007 is the darkest color, while #fff5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ff1dc8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#978592 is the less saturated color, while #ff1dc8 is the most saturated one.
